Transaction 5520edbb08af6f2030721eeaaccec84fa6daedb57e60fe5be7d749865cf3daf9

1 Input
2 Outputs
  • 5520edbb08af6f2030721eeaaccec84fa6daedb57e60fe5be7d749865cf3daf9:0
  • value  667133
    address  35BY8u5qkfhsxNWteJWHFa1paVaNKoqqZZ
  • 5520edbb08af6f2030721eeaaccec84fa6daedb57e60fe5be7d749865cf3daf9:1
  • value  175413649
    address  3MXWKnt6CRXRHcVm2fyLq4SdG2FQpDPUux